In an era when artificial intelligence has become a trusted interlocutor for millions, researchers have turned a measuring instrument toward one of its most unsettling tendencies — the confident fabrication of falsehood. A new study benchmarks major AI systems against verifiable reality, revealing that hallucination rates vary dramatically across models, and that the choice of which system to trust is far from arbitrary.
